断熱材。[Claims for Utility Model Registration] 1. Orienting short glass fibers 1 to form a base material 7,
A heat insulating material characterized in that a part of these short glass fibers 1 is oriented in the thickness direction of the base material 7 to form a felt body 2, and silica 3 is attached to the surface of the short glass fibers 1. Material. 2 Short glass fiber 1 contains 40 to 7 long glass fibers 5
The heat insulating material according to claim 1 of the utility model registration claim, which is cut to 0 mm. 3. The heat insulating material according to claim 1, wherein the felt body 2 is formed by punching the base material 7 from at least one side in the thickness direction with a needle 8. 4. The heat insulating material according to claim 1, wherein the silica 3 on the surface of the short glass fiber 1 is left after drying the felt body 2 impregnated with silica sol 9.
